With Brushless motors and a high end Lipo is the power/punch to much in 1/10th Modified 2wd and Truck ?
I'm asking this because we released a single cell Lipo for 1/12th scale and I'm thinking of trying single cell in mod offroad. I'm pretty sure it would make the motors smoother which should be good on many of the low traction tracks.
We could do a 12000 pack in the current ROAR hardcase.

I dont think the lipo's are too much. I think a lot of people grossly over motor. Going to a single cell would require much hotter motors. I remember when 5 cell was being tested, in 2whl mod you went form a 12-13 turn to a 9 turn. Being that a single cell would only be 3.7v it would require at least a 4.5 to compare to a 7.5, maybe more. Wouldnt a reciever pack be required as well?

Yeah, wrong direction in my opinion. Why go to a higher current less efficient setup? As overall power is going up???
In general this is opposite of where the hobby is headed, many are bashing with 3 and 4S. While I have disagreed with the desire by some to take racing to a higher voltage, tradeoffs there as well, they do have a point, why go the other way, seems even less desirable to me.
This would require new higher current, more expensive I suspect, chargers for many/most of us. Granted, we wouldn’t need balancers, now that many have just invested in that. One of the most expensive items in the car, the speed control, a lot of development for smooth throttle profiles has occurred, would probably end up being redeveloped/repurchased. Same with motors, most guys have even more invested in motors, that would definitely be immediately obsolete/wrong. Stock and mod. New servos as well. Then the whole power the receiver thingy.
Let the 12th scale guys deal with it in my opinion. No biggie though, if somebody wants to run 1S wouldn’t it be legal? I mean, you can run 5 old school cells if you want can’t you? Like in the old 7 cell days, you could still run 6.
I don't think we are in the same situation as Touring cars. We get more than a heat or two at the big races!!!
So I vote no thanks.

This is my personal experience:
NiMH 7,2 v and brusless is overpowered for 2WD. Going to 5 cells made it much smoother with a 6,5 turn. Even tried with 4 cells (4,8 v) and a 3,5 turn - which was super smooth. But the motor (and ESC I think) got very hot. And runtime is critical.
So LiPo (7,4 v) and brushless for 2WD is defo overpowered. Whichever solution provides the smoothest feel would be my favorite. And without anything geeting too hot....
I have a feeling 7,4 v is kinda ok, but we'd need smoother motors (maybe smaller?)

Thanks for the info. I agree using a higher turn motor is most likely the way to go but this could give us a different tuning option as I bet the power band would be different.
We will have sample packs to test and see what it will do in an actual car.
Novak has a Booster Circuit coming out that will bump the voltage up to 6 volts for the servo with built in cutoff.
I know a hotter motor would have to be used but so far in 12th scale this has meant lower motor temps.
For those who think weight would be lower it wouldn't as this pack would have the same number of cells as a 2S2P pack.
